Roundworms: Parasitic Infection, Pinworm Symptoms, Treatment

WebRoundworms are small organisms that can live in your intestine, which is part of your digestive system. Roundworms can live in the human intestine for a long time. They can be harmful and cause many problems, including abdominal (belly) pain, fever and diarrhea. WebJun 11, 2010 · Worms cause a variety of health issues which go undiagnosed. The WHO estimates that worm infections are the single greatest cause of anemia in children in the world. If you travel to a lot of countries with poor hygiene, or …

There are several types of fiber. Each works differently in … WebJul 13, 2024 · Good sanitation is key in preventing worm infection in dogs, especially in multiple dog households. Keeping food and water bowls clean and free from contamination contributes greatly to controlling the transmission of intestinal worms between dogs. Regular deworming doses, usually given every 3 to 6 months, also help control intestinal …
